To download the latest drivers for the Riso SF5030 Digital Duplicator
, you should use the official RISO Global or regional download centers. These drivers allow your computer to recognize and manage the printing hardware directly. Official Download Resources
RISO Global Download Center: You can find the latest SF9x5x/SF5xxx EII Series drivers here. These packages typically include support for the model.
Windows 64-bit Driver (Ver. 3.50.00): Supports Windows 11, 10, and 8.1.
Windows 32-bit Driver (Ver. 3.50.00): Specifically for 32-bit versions of Windows 10 and 8.1. RISO US Print Driver Center: Use the RISO US Resources to search by category ("Digital Duplicator") and model (" Riso Sf5030 Printer Drivers Download
") to find regional-specific versions in English, Spanish, or French. Installation Tips
Connection Order: Do not connect the USB cable to your computer until the installer specifically instructs you to do so.
Legacy Support: If you need a driver for an older operating system not listed on the website, RISO recommends emailing driversupport@riso.com for assistance.
User Guide: For step-by-step setup instructions, refer to the RISO Printer Driver User's Guide often provided as a PDF within the driver download package. Print Drivers - Riso To download the latest drivers for the Riso

Issue: "Unsupported Operating System"
- Solution: Riso high-speed printers sometimes lag behind Windows updates. If you are on the newest version of Windows 11 and a driver isn't listed:
- Download the Windows 10 driver.
- Right-click the installer > Properties > Compatibility.
- Run in "Windows 8" or "Windows 10" compatibility mode.

4. Installation Guide (Windows)
Once the driver file (usually a .zip or .exe archive) is downloaded, follow these steps:
- Extract the Files: If the file is a ZIP, right-click and "Extract All" to a folder on your desktop. Do not try to run the install directly from inside the ZIP file, as this often causes errors.
- Locate the Installer: Open the extracted folder. Look for
Setup.exeorInstall.exe. - Run as Administrator: Right-click the installer and select "Run as Administrator".
- Connection Type:
- Network Connection: The installer will search the network for the SF5030. Ensure the printer is powered on and connected to the same network. Select it when it appears.
- USB Connection: Connect the cable when prompted by the installer or after the installation is complete.
- Finish: Follow the on-screen prompts to finish the installation.
